Cracking or Peeling Off Surfaces
When the paint on your home's outside begins to show splitting or peeling off surfaces, it suggests a need for attention and upkeep to maintain the home's visual allure. Cracking occurs when the paint movie splits open, usually appearing like a dried-up riverbed, while peeling off happens when the paint sheds its bond to the surface area underneath it.
These problems not only diminish the aesthetics of your home yet also jeopardize the security the paint provides against the elements.
Cracking and peeling surface areas can be caused by different aspects such as poor surface preparation prior to paint, use of low-quality paint, exposure to rough weather conditions, or just the natural aging of the paint. Ignoring these indications can bring about more damages to the underlying surface areas, possibly leading to more comprehensive and expensive fixings in the future.
To resolve cracking or peeling off surfaces, it is critical to remove the loose paint, sand the location, use a guide, and paint the damaged areas. By taking timely action to correct these problems, you can preserve your home's exterior appeal and secure it from possible damage.

Wood Rot or Water Damages
Discovery of timber rot or water damage on your home's surface areas requires instant interest to stop further architectural deterioration and maintain the stability of the home. Wood rot, a result of extended exposure to dampness, can deteriorate the structure of your home, endangering its security. Typical indications of timber rot include soft or squishy locations, discoloration, or a moldy odor.
Water damages, typically triggered by leakages or poor drainage, can cause peeling paint, swollen wood, or water discolorations on walls. If left unchecked, water damages can rise, triggering much more substantial and expensive repair services.
To attend to wood rot or water damage, start by recognizing and fixing the source of the problem to prevent future damages.
